Boston: Lothrop Publishing Company, 1904. Hardcover. Very Good. First edition, first printing (October, 1904); 5 1/4" x 7 1/2"; pp. [8], 5-471, [7] publisher's list; original bright green pictorial boards; gilt title; few minor rubbed spots to head and tail of spine and corners; front cover fine, back cover with faint spotting; small gift inscription to first free page; very good or better. Illustrated in black & white by Eugenie Wireman. The ninth book in the 'Little Peppers' series.
